The collaboration between P.A. Alvarez Properties and Development Corporation (P.A. Properties) and Japan’s Hankyu Hanshin Properties Corp. (HHPC), known as P.A. Properties Hankyu Hanshin, has proudly unveiled Idesia Cabuyao East, a fresh Japanese-inspired community in Cabuyao, Laguna.
The launch featured a ribbon-cutting ceremony, a house blessing for the new Mori model unit, and Kagami Biraki, a traditional Japanese ceremony symbolizing prosperity and good fortune. This achievement marks the seventh joint venture of P.A. Properties Hankyu Hanshin (PAHH), adding to their successful subdivision projects in Dasmariñas, Lipa, San Jose del Monte, and Cabuyao.
“Atty. Marianne Reyna Lina-Cruz,” President & CEO of P.A. Properties remarked that they are dedicated to ensuring that Idesia Cabuyao East meets the highest standards of development with a strong focus on sustainability and quality.
Building on the success of the first Idesia project in Cabuyao city, PAHH aims to enhance homeowners’ experience by offering spaces designed to foster belongingness – which is harmonized with the ongoing developments within Cabuyao City such as North-South Commuter Railway.
The newly launched Mori model unit at Idesia Cabuyao East is designed for growing families; it is equipped with living space spanning 62.70 sq.m., spread across 100 sq.m lot area featuring three bedrooms apart from other amenities like living area, dining room kitchen service area along with toilet & bath facilities carport and balcony reflecting its cultural inspiration from Japan.
